Update 4:35 PM EST: Droid-Life now has good news, that there will be more supply than previously thought. Two of the largest VZ distribution centers, Memphis, and Fontana have just been re-stocked completely, and are shipping more to retail stores. Throw that 25,000 device total away. There will be many more Droid X's available on July 15th than that. More info
here



A few days ago, Droid-Life broke the story that a limited supply of Droid X devices will be available on the July 15th launch date. According to leaked documents, Verizon's main Memphis warehouse shipped out as little as 25,000 Droid X's to Verizon stores, which seems to be a gross underestimation for the demand the device will likely see. Then, more leaked documents surfaced yesterday, indicating that many retail stores in NYC, Los Angeles, Las Vegas, Philadelphia, and Houston will be receiving as few as 5 Droid X devices each.

Today, in a CNN interview, Verizon Spokeswoman Brenda Raney denounced these rumors:

"While we are currently experiencing delays on orders of one of our more popular phones. We view that as an anomaly driven by a combination of supply and popularity," she said. "At present, we feel that we have done everything possible to ensure we have inventory to meet customer needs around the Droid X--the proof will be in the execution on July 15."
According to Raney, the Droid X will not suffer the same fate as that other "popular phone" (the Droid Incredible), and believes there will be enough Droid X's to meet demand on July 15th.
